Export wheat rally amid broadening demand shock waves
Chicago reports a surge in export demand lifting wheat prices by six cents from Thursday. Trading ended with gains of five cents. December wheat settled at 1.23 and 1.30 for other contracts, marking the highest level since the European war began.

Indicted After Food Probe in Washington
A federal grand jury returned thirty two indictments against Washington commission merchants and produce dealers. They are accused of fixing prices daily on food stuffs by ballots or verbal agreements to inflate costs under the Sherman act. Bail was arranged for court appearance. no allied nations named.

Wilson Urges $100 Million Yearly Tax Rise
President Wilson addressed Congress urging a $100,000,000 annual revenue boost from internal taxes to close a treasury deficit caused by the European conflict. He warned against undermining treasury strength by draining national bank deposits and stressed the duty to act despite personal desire for relief.

Palmer heads G A A chosen for next meeting place
Comrade David slow pent Cee Stan not Teal Afth Iowa regiments in the Civil War was elected commander in chief of the Grand Army of the Republic at the forty eighth national encampment in Detroit. Washington DC was unanimously chosen for the encampment site next year. Other officers elected include Senior vice commander in chief J B Griswold Grand Rapids Mich Junior vice commander in chief F W Connera Dallas Tex Surgeon general L S Pilcher Brooklyn NY Chaplain in chief Orville J Nave California.

Russia and German Reinforcements Amid War Front Shifts
Vienna reports 40 000 German troops rushed to Galicia to aid Austria against a Russian assault near Lemberg. Petrograd confirms Lem berg Czernowitz and Zolkiew captured as Russian forces push 250 miles. Seven German torpedo boats damaged near Kiel. some sunk. Japan readies Panama Exposition exhibit. Germany reportedly issues ultimatum to Holland.

Turkish mines in Dardanelles block Russian Black Sea fleet
Reports from Rome Athens and Paris describe Turkish mines in the Dardanelles bottling the Russian Black Sea squadron and note unconfirmed rumors of Muslim clerics urging holy war. Armenian violence near Van is also mentioned amid broader World War I front updates and troop movements around Paris.

Gloom Over London as German Advance Is Reported Halting
London reports that the German right wing has been checked and forced to retire toward St Quentin, with Brussels dispatches noting delays to Paris attack. Cor respondents in Antwerp say cavalry at Compiegne repulsed, while Basel sources mention unconfirmed German crossing into Switzerland. Paris authorities prepare for potential fallbacks as tens of thousands flee the capital.
